The Eric Sherman crew in front “WEREWOLF !” # 42-7572. Standing, left to right: Sgt William S. Lutes; Sgt Leiding C. Olson; Sgt William Kopczynski; Sgt William A. McDonald; Sgt Euylse E. Jackson. Kneeling, left to right: Captain Eric H. Sherman; 2/Lt Charles S. Clark (did not fly on the 21 July 1944 mission on 42-100315 “Quivering Box”); 1/Lt Glenn W. Hoffman and 1/Lt Nelson T. Segraves. Not in photo: Captain Calvin T. Ballard, Lt Hohn E. Hand and S/Sgt John T. Clay, all three KIA in the loss of 42-100315. ( Photo via Navigator Glenn W. Hoffman’s family)
